Extension functions

Composer.materialize

fun Composer.materialize(modifier: Modifier): Modifier

Materialize any instance-specific composed modifiers for applying to a raw tree node. Call right before setting the returned modifier on an emitted node. You almost certainly do not need to call this function directly.

CompositionLocalAccessorScope.mediaQuery

@ExperimentalMediaQueryApi
inline fun CompositionLocalAccessorScope.mediaQuery(query: UiMediaScope.() -> Boolean): Boolean

Evaluates a boolean query against the current UiMediaScope from a CompositionLocalAccessorScope.

If called within a snapshot-aware context, the specific property reads within the query will be tracked, and the scope will be invalidated when any of those properties change.

Parameters
query: UiMediaScope.() -> Boolean

A lambda expression with UiMediaScope as its receiver, representing the condition to check.

Returns
Boolean

The immediate boolean result of the query.

CompositionLocalConsumerModifierNode.mediaQuery

@ExperimentalMediaQueryApi
inline fun CompositionLocalConsumerModifierNode.mediaQuery(query: UiMediaScope.() -> Boolean): Boolean

Evaluates a boolean query against the current UiMediaScope from a Modifier.Node.

This function is designed to be used within a Modifier.Node that implements CompositionLocalConsumerModifierNode.

If called within a snapshot-aware context like LayoutModifierNode.measure or DrawModifierNode.draw callbacks, the reads within the query will be tracked, and the scope will be invalidated when the properties change.

Parameters
query: UiMediaScope.() -> Boolean

A lambda expression with UiMediaScope as its receiver, representing the condition to check.

Returns
Boolean

The immediate boolean result of the query.

Top-level properties

LocalUiMediaScope

@ExperimentalMediaQueryApi
val LocalUiMediaScopeProvidableCompositionLocal<UiMediaScope>

A UiMediaScope provides information about the window environment and input devices, enabling adaptive layouts and behavior. This CompositionLocal is the primary mechanism to access the scope within the composable tree.

It is typically provided at the root of an application. Accessing it without a provider will result in a runtime error.
